Chemical Composition

Standard chemical composition ranges for cold-drawn mechanical tubing grades (%)
Grade (AISI/SAE) Equivalent (EN) C Mn P (≤) S (≤) Si
1010C10E / 1.11210.08–0.130.30–0.600.0300.0350.10–0.30
1020C20E / 1.11510.18–0.230.30–0.600.0300.0350.10–0.30
1035C35E / 1.11810.32–0.380.50–0.800.0300.0350.15–0.35
1045C45E / 1.11910.43–0.500.60–0.900.0300.0350.15–0.35
1060C60E / 1.12210.55–0.650.60–0.900.0300.0350.15–0.35

Compositional ranges align with standard SAE and EN specifications for cold-drawn mechanical tubing. Minor adjustments to Mn or Si may be applied during steelmaking to optimize cold-drawing response or hardenability, subject to customer approval.

Manufacturing Process

Smelting Route: Our carbon steel billets are produced via EAF + LF + VD to ensure low gas content, tight inclusion control, and consistent chemistry. For applications demanding superior fatigue life or ultra-clean microstructures, we offer ESR or VIM + VAR upon request.

Tube Manufacturing: Production begins with hot-rolled seamless piercing, followed by rotary rolling and sizing. For precision shock absorber tubes, the mother tubes undergo spheroidize annealing, pickling, and multi-pass cold drawing or cold rolling. This is followed by stress-relief or normalization heat treatment, precision straightening, and cutting.

For hydraulic cylinder applications, we further process cold-drawn tubes through internal honing or skiving & roller burnishing (SRB). Mechanical Properties

Typical longitudinal mechanical properties for precision damper tubing (WT ≤ 16 mm)
Grade Condition Tensile Strength (MPa) Yield Strength (MPa) Elongation (%) ≥ Hardness (HBW)
1010 / C10ECold Drawn (BK)≥ 380≥ 28010≤ 130
1010 / C10ENormalized (NBK)310–410≥ 18525≤ 120
1020 / C20ECold Drawn (BK)≥ 420≥ 32010≤ 150
1020 / C20ENormalized (NBK)350–450≥ 21522≤ 140
1045 / C45ECold Drawn (BK)≥ 580≥ 4508≤ 190
1045 / C45ENormalized (NBK)500–650≥ 30516≤ 180
1045 / C45EQuenched & Tempered650–850≥ 43014190–230
1060 / C60EQuenched & Tempered750–950≥ 50012210–260

Data represents longitudinal test specimens. Properties for thicker sections or transverse orientations may vary slightly according to standard allowances. Custom mechanical targets can be achieved through adjusted cold-work reduction ratios and tailored heat treatment cycles.

Heat Treatment

Recommended thermal processing cycles for shock absorber tubing
Treatment Type Temperature Range (°C) Soaking Time Cooling Method Application / Notes
Spheroidize Annealing680–7202–4 hrsFurnace cool to ≤ 500°CSoftens medium/high-carbon grades for cold drawing; improves machinability
Normalizing850–9001 hr per 25 mm WTStill airRefines grain structure, restores ductility after cold working
Stress Relieving550–6501–2 hrsAir or furnace coolRemoves residual stresses from cold drawing; stabilizes dimensions
Quenching820–86030–60 minOil or water quenchApplied to 1045/1060 for high strength; requires immediate tempering
Tempering450–6501–2 hrsAir coolAdjusts final hardness/toughness balance after quenching

For precision cold-drawn tubes, all heat treatments are conducted in controlled-atmosphere or protective-gas furnaces to prevent surface decarburization and scaling. Induction hardening of the inner bore is also available for 1045/1060 grades when enhanced wear resistance against piston seals is required.

Surface Finish & Tolerances

Fushun Steel Tube delivers shock absorber tubes with surface conditions matched to your assembly and sealing requirements:

  • Hot-Rolled Seamless: Available as-rolled (black surface) or pickled. Suitable for outer reserve cylinders or non-sealing structural sleeves.
  • Cold-Drawn Precision: Bright finish with tight dimensional control. Standard tolerances: OD ±0.10 mm (or ISO h8/h9), WT ±5–8%. Ideal for inner working cylinders requiring consistent piston clearance.
  • Honed / SRB Tubes: Internal surface roughness Ra ≤ 0.4 μm (standard), with options down to Ra ≤ 0.2 μm for high-performance damping applications. ID tolerance typically H8/H9.
  • External Machining: OD turning or centerless grinding available upon request, achieving h7/h6 tolerances and Ra ≤ 0.8 μm for press-fit or threaded assembly interfaces.

All surface processing is performed in-house, ensuring traceability and eliminating intermediate handling damage.

Quality Assurance & Testing

Quality is embedded at every stage of our production chain. Fushun Steel Tube operates under an ISO 9001 certified management system, with inspection protocols aligned to international tubing standards:

  • Raw Material Verification: Optical emission spectrometry (OES) for full chemical analysis; inclusion rating and macrostructure review.
  • In-Process Control: Laser diameter monitoring, ultrasonic wall-thickness measurement, and straightness checks after each drawing pass.
  • Non-Destructive Testing (NDT): Ultrasonic testing (UT) and Eddy Current testing (ET) for defect detection; Magnetic Particle inspection (MT) for end regions.
  • Hydrostatic Test: Pressure testing to validate structural integrity and leak-tightness.
  • Mechanical & Metallographic: Tensile, yield, elongation, hardness, Charpy impact (if specified), and grain size evaluation.
  • Certification & Third-Party: Every shipment includes an EN 10204 3.1 Mill Test Certificate. EN 10204 3.2 certification with independent witness testing can be arranged. We welcome SGS, TÜV, or BV inspections.

Which grade do you recommend for inner working cylinders vs. outer reserve tubes?
For inner cylinders where bore finish and seal compatibility are critical, AISI 1020 / EN C20E (normalized or stress-relieved) is the industry standard. For outer reserve tubes, AISI 1010 / EN C10E provides excellent formability and cost efficiency. Heavy-duty applications often specify AISI 1045 / EN C45E with induction-hardened bores.
